[BEATO, FELICE. 1832-1909.]
Panorama of Lucknow taken from the Kaiserbagh, 6 lightly albumenized prints joined, each 10 x 12 inches, 1858, captioned on verso in ink and with several sites identified in pencil on verso, separation at 3 folds but with little if any loss.
Provenance: likely purchased by W.J.H. in India in 1858; with Maggs, December, 1959; thence by descent.
The Kaiserbagh was the palace of the King of Oudh, and a symbolic stronghold of the mutineers, many of whom had originally been recruited by the British from among the former army of the state of Oudh. The palace was recaptured by Sir Colin Campbell on March 14, 1858.
